The Importance of Brake Drums


Brake drums are cylindrical components that work in conjunction with brake shoes. When the driver applies the brakes, the shoes press against the inside surface of the drum to create friction, which slows down the vehicle. While disc brakes are more commonly used in modern vehicles, drum brakes remain prevalent, particularly in older models and on the rear axle of some cars.


Regular inspection of brake drums is vital because worn or damaged drums can adversely affect braking performance, leading to potential safety hazards. Consequently, maintenance might entail either resurfacing the existing drums or replacing them altogether.


Factors Influencing Brake Drum Prices


1. Material Quality The material used in crafting brake drums significantly affects their price. Most brake drums are made of cast iron, which provides durability and strength. However, premium options, such as those made from composite materials or with advanced heat dissipation features, tend to be priced higher due to their enhanced performance and longevity.

2. Brand Reputation Just like with any automobile part, the brand plays a significant role in pricing. Established brands that have a reputation for reliability and performance often charge a premium for their products. Conversely, lesser-known brands may offer more affordable options, but buyers should exercise caution as these may not meet the same quality standards.


3. Vehicle Compatibility The specific make and model of a vehicle can affect brake drum prices. Uncommon or specialty vehicles often require more expensive components due to lower production volumes, while standard models may have more readily available and competitively priced parts.


4. Cadence of Purchase The condition of existing brake drums will also dictate whether they need immediate replacement or if they can be resurfaced. Resurfacing is generally less expensive than full replacement but is only feasible if the drums are not overly worn or damaged. On average, a complete drum replacement can range from $40 to $250 per drum, depending on the aforementioned factors.


5. Labor Costs The cost of installation can also significantly affect the total price when replacing brake drums. Labor costs vary widely by region and service provider. While some opt for DIY installation, which can save money, others may prefer to have the job done by professionals to ensure optimal safety and performance.
